Wait, which QB in the draft would you take before Garoppolo?

Personally, I would take Watson over Garoppolo at this point in their careers. Garoppolo's solid excellent starts (but narrow victories) with the champion Patriots against the super bowl hangover Cards and floundering Fins this year isn't a great predictor of what he can do for these struggling teams. You also have to factor in that he will be a free agent in 2018, meaning he has to want to play for you to even consider trading a high draft pick for him and his cap hit starting next year will be significantly higher than the rookies. Remember, most of these teams interested aren't just a QB away from the playoffs. They need help in many areas.

There are others available like Hoyer, Glennon, Foles, etc, who have also had brief stretches of very good play that will be significantly cheaper, both in cap and aquisition costs. He could very well be Matt Flynn (or Hoyer, Glennon, Foles, etc) for all we know right now. He's likely better, but not at the cost of a 1st rounder IMO.
